Aurelien Colson is a contemporary figure known for his contributions to the field of mediation and negotiation. His work emphasizes innovative approaches to conflict resolution, particularly through his book, "Mediation: Negotiation by Other Moves." In this book, Colson explores the dynamics of mediation, providing insights into how negotiators can navigate complex interpersonal interactions effectively. His theories and methodologies are grounded in practical applications, making them valuable for both practitioners and scholars alike.

Colson's approach to mediation is characterized by a deep understanding of human behavior and communication. He believes that successful mediation requires not only technical skills but also emotional intelligence and the ability to empathize with differing perspectives. Through his writings and teachings, he has influenced a new generation of mediators, encouraging them to adopt a more holistic view of negotiation processes, one that integrates various moves and strategies to achieve constructive outcomes. His influence extends into various fields, including law, business, and psychology, showcasing the interdisciplinary nature of his work.
